Webb4 mars 2024 · Suicide is remarkably common in the tragedies of Sophocles, occurring in four of his seven extant plays (whereas there are no suicides at all in the extant plays of his older contemporary Aeschylus). In Antigone, no fewer than three characters kill themselves, and it is a revealing study of different types of suicide. Webb5 dec. 2024 · Role of The Chorus in Antigone. The Chorus is most of the plays of Sophocles do not play any active or decisive part. They are by and large ‘spectators idealized’, and do not take any mentionable share in the action.They are often emotionally connected with the principle characters. They feel for them, but do nothing.
